About Loaral and Clinton....it was a business decision by upper loral management- -mostly Bernie Schwartz. And contrary to what McKee claims, Bernie was Clinton's single largest individual contributor.

But China offered a cheap ride to geosynchronous orbit, where communications satellites (mostly) live. The trouble is, they had a long history of guidance problems- -like turnng sideways soon after launch and hitting and blowing things up. The one previous to Loral's launch hit the village next to the launch pad, killing thousands (China, under much pressure, eventually admitted to 6 dead). Bernie wanted the cheap ride, but not the explosion. He sent a team of engineers over there to teach the Chinese how to make a working guidance system. Illegal under then-current and still current US law- -but who was going o prosecute him? He'd bought the Prexy. He succeeded. The satellite made geosync orbit. It was one of the Intelsat series (VII, I think).

But if you van put a satellite in geosync orbit, you can put a nuclear warhead on any city in the world.
